I plan on hardwiring in a resistor to the feeders of a manual thrown switch to have feedback if it is left open after a crew has left the location. The frog polarity will change using a micro slide switch so the detection unit will only see the resistance if the frog is powered a certain way. My question is what wattage of resistor would be best? It seems that most wheelsets out there are 10kohm for detection, and I have 1/8 and 1/2 watt resistors with the same resistance.
Would W = V^2 be appropriate? So, W = 15^2/10000 = 0.0225, an 1/8 watt resistor would be sufficient?
Layout is DCC with an SB5 booster. I plan on using RR CirKits BOD-8 boards with the coils around feeders to the stock rail of the switch.
